Zusammenfassung: | In article number 2000938, Zi Yin, Junxin Lin, and co‐workers identify a novel musculoskeletal stem cell population by single‐cell transcriptional profiling with lineage tracing data during limb development. The differentiation potential and trajectory of musculoskeletal stem cells showed they could contribute to soft and hard connective tissues, as well as muscular tissue. These results suggest an indispensable role of limb Scx+ musculoskeletal stem cell population in musculoskeletal system morphogenesis. |
